Umberto Eco (* 5. January 1932 in Alessandria; † 19. February 2016 in Milan) was an italian semiotician, essayist, philosopher, literary critic, and novelist. He was 84 years old. He was married to Renate Ramge. He studied at University of Turin. His faith was atheism. He received 10 awards, including Officer of the Legion of Honour, Commandeur des Arts et des Lettres. His cause of death was pancreatic cancer.
